If you have small children, you can let them run around freely knowing that there is only one entrance/exit and that there will be no cars or traffic. Tons of space. There is a boating lake which may only be open at weekends. Also, there is a roundabout at the north east corner of the park, again mabe only open at weekends. If you go up to the top of the tower, you can see for miles over the Mediterranean sea and also get a great view over Carihuela. One unusual feature of the park, is a tree where parents hang their childs dummy when they have grown too old for it. Looks crazy but it's quite a nice touch.
